When to Know It's Time for Septic System Maintenance
Experts say you should have your system pumped every one to two years, but several factors should be considered when deciding how often your septic tank needs to be serviced. These include:
- Number of people in your household
- Size of your tank and property
- Amount of usage from garbage disposal, laundry, and more
- Age of the system

Our 3-Step Septic Tank Maintenance Plan
Septic Tank Pumping
The first step we take is pumping your septic tank or cesspool to remove all the sludge and debris that has accumulated over time. We’ll also inspect the tank for any potential issues or necessary repairs.
Bacterial Additive Products
Following this, we'll utilize our proven additives. First up, our Septic System Treatment, a bacterial additive product that counteracts the harmful effects of household cleaning products on your septic system's necessary bacteria – one quart every other month is usually all you need.
We also add our Boost, a solution of enzymes that help break down organic waste such as food products and grease. It is essentially a shock treatment for your septic tank and, true to its name, will give your tank the bacteria boost it needs to break down solids.
Septic System Filter Cleaning
Lastly, we'll clean out your septic system's filter to ensure it functions properly and protects your leach field from any potential clogs or issues. If you have a cesspool – rather than a septic system –a filter is not an option, so it’s even more important to follow the first two steps in maintaining a healthy septic system.
